Squirrel Hill-based Good Grief Center for Bereavement Support (GGC), a service of Ursuline Support Services, is seeking Service Volunteers to provide grief education, resources, and referrals to people who are grieving. Organizational Support Volunteers are also being recruited to assist with office and program activities such as mailings, computer data entry, filing, emails, reception duties and/or phone calls. Training is provided for all. For more information about volunteering at the Good Grief Center, please call GGC at 412-224-4700 . Please consider becoming a member of our volunteer team today.

Description

The Good Grief Center for Bereavement Support is the region’s first and only comprehensive center dedicated exclusively to bereavement education, resources, and referrals for all ages. The Good Grief Center merged with Ursuline Support Services in 2011, becoming Ursuline’s newest service and furthering Ursuline’s commitment to supporting those vulnerable in our communities through life’s transitions.
